Understanding Bitcoin Remittances: Bitcoin remittances involve transferring Bitcoin from one digital wallet to another. Unlike traditional banking systems, which rely on intermediaries like banks and payment processors, Bitcoin transactions are peer-to-peer, facilitated by a distributed ledger technology known as blockchain. This eliminates the need for intermediaries, potentially reducing costs and processing times. The sender initiates a transaction by broadcasting it to the Bitcoin network. Miners verify the transaction and add it to a block, which is then added to the blockchain, confirming the transfer. The recipient receives the Bitcoin in their wallet once the transaction is confirmed, usually within minutes to an hour, depending on network congestion and transaction fees.

Benefits of Using Bitcoin for Remittances:
Lower Fees: Compared to traditional remittance services, which often charge substantial fees, especially for international transfers, Bitcoin transactions typically have significantly lower fees. While transaction fees on the Bitcoin network itself fluctuate based on network congestion, they are generally lower than those charged by traditional providers.
Faster Transactions: Bitcoin transactions can be processed much faster than traditional bank transfers, which can take days or even weeks for international transfers to complete. While confirmation times vary, they are generally much quicker than traditional methods.
Global Accessibility: Bitcoin transcends geographical boundaries. Anyone with a Bitcoin wallet and an internet connection can send and receive Bitcoin anywhere in the world, making it particularly beneficial in regions with limited access to traditional banking services.
Increased Transparency: Every Bitcoin transaction is recorded on the public blockchain, providing a transparent and auditable record of the transfer. This can enhance security and accountability.
Enhanced Security: While Bitcoin itself is not inherently immune to security risks, the use of strong security practices, such as two-factor authentication and secure wallets, can significantly enhance the security of Bitcoin remittances.

Drawbacks of Using Bitcoin for Remittances:
Volatility: Bitcoin's price is highly volatile, meaning that the value of the Bitcoin received might fluctuate between the time of sending and receiving, potentially impacting the recipient's final amount.
Regulatory Uncertainty: The regulatory landscape for cryptocurrencies is still evolving globally. Regulations vary across jurisdictions, which can create uncertainty and complexity for users.
Technical Complexity: Understanding Bitcoin wallets, private keys, and transaction fees can be challenging for users unfamiliar with cryptocurrency technology.
Security Risks: While secure, Bitcoin wallets can be vulnerable to hacking or theft if not properly secured. Users need to be aware of the security risks and take appropriate precautions.
Scalability Issues: The Bitcoin network can experience congestion during periods of high transaction volume, leading to delays and higher transaction fees.


Security Best Practices for Bitcoin Remittances:
Use a reputable Bitcoin wallet: Choose a wallet with a strong security reputation and features like two-factor authentication.
Secure your private keys: Never share your private keys with anyone and store them securely offline.
Verify recipient addresses carefully: Double-check the recipient's Bitcoin address before sending the transaction to avoid irreversible loss of funds.
Use a hardware wallet for larger transactions: Hardware wallets offer an extra layer of security for storing your Bitcoin.
Be aware of phishing scams: Beware of fraudulent websites or emails that attempt to steal your Bitcoin credentials.

The Future of Bitcoin Remittances:

Bitcoin remittances are likely to continue growing in popularity as the technology matures and regulations become clearer. The development of the Lightning Network, a second-layer scaling solution, could help address scalability issues and reduce transaction fees further. As adoption increases, we can expect more user-friendly interfaces and services to make Bitcoin remittances more accessible to a wider range of users. However, ongoing challenges related to volatility, regulation, and security will need to be addressed to ensure the long-term viability and sustainability of Bitcoin as a prominent remittance method.
